Editor:
As most of you know, my last day at KRIM Radio (was) Aug. 31. The decision to leave was solely mine because of a new job opportunity. I have loved every minute at KRIM and urge you to continue to support this jewel of Rim Country. Community involvement and quality programming have always been priorities at KRIM and that will not change.
A new door of opportunity has opened for me, and I look forward to facing the challenge of a new career. To the special underwriters and sponsors, I thank you for your love and support, you are what makes this town tick!
To Steve Bingham, thank you for allowing me the freedom to take KRIM to the top and make it the successful community broadcast station that it is. To the local musicians, my heartfelt thanks for sharing your talents and being there whenever I needed you for a charity or benefit. And to the listeners, you have been my drive and inspiration.
My eternal thanks for the encouragement and love you showed me every day. I encourage each and every one of you to support KRIM and to continue your loyalty and dedication. Last, but not least, “Thanks for turning me on.”
Suzanne Michaels
